Manchester United midfielder Hannibal Mejbri is being considered as a potential candidate for a loan move.
In what could be a defining moment in the career of young talent Hannibal Mejbri, the Manchester United midfielder finds himself at the center of transfer speculations. According to reputable Tunisian outlet
, the 20-year-old is garnering interest from three clubs keen on securing his services on loan for the upcoming season.
While the identity of one of the clubs remains undisclosed, it is understood that Luton Town and Enzo Maresca’s Leicester City are among the frontrunners vying for the gifted midfielder’s signature.
Despite making appearances during Manchester United’s pre-season tour under Erik Ten Hag, Mejbri faces fierce competition in the defensive midfield position. With players of the caliber of Casemiro and the potential addition of Sofyan Amrabat, it seems unlikely that the Tunisian international will be able to secure regular first-team football in the forthcoming season.
In light of this situation, several clubs, including the recently promoted Luton Town, are actively pursuing the talented youngster for a temporary stint. Mejbri, who spent the previous season on loan at Birmingham City, may find another loan move as the most appropriate pathway to further his development and gain valuable playing time.
